Of Facebook's1.25 billion monthly active users, 44% Like their friends' postsat least once a day -- and 29% do it multiple times a day. That'shundreds of millions of people interacting with content on the social network on a daily basis.

So what motivates people to Like Facebook posts -- and share them, and comment on them? And why should businesses care?

Research has found several psychological reasons behind why users enjoy using Facebook so much. Free Guide: How to Market on Facebook & Instagram

For example,studies observing people browsing on Facebookfound psychological indications of happiness, like pupil dilation. By uncovering this type of audience insight, marketers can apply this information to create more effective Facebook marketing campaigns.
